Cheap hostels Amsterdam is the most affordable option providing ample opportunities for fun and entertainment.
However, these hostels are not appropriate for those who are in look for absolute privacy and peaceful seclusion. Particularly when you land up with your partner and require a cheap and affordable accommodation for yourself along with a private bathroom provision, you would never be able to find it in one of the cheap hostels in Amsterdam. Amsterdam Cheap hostels offer a housing facility where multiple entities have to share one particular room and even bathrooms situated in each floor of the apartment. It would be better if you take your own towels and sleeping bags because some youth hostels in Amsterdam charge extra for such articles. Most of the hostels in Amsterdam are well accommodated, comprising common eating rooms, lockers, some board and card games and Internet access.
Cheap hostels in Amsterdam remains fully jammed with tourists in almost all seasons of the year particularly on weekends and during special occasions and celebrations. Thus, in order to avoid unnecessary rush and hassle, you should make prior reservation and avoid unnecessary harassment. Cheap hostels Amsterdam are located a little further, around the region of Warmoesstraat. You will surely get to see multiple affordable campsites and youth hostels in and around the city of Amsterdam. It is very difficult to get accommodations in these hostels especially during summer and during other seasons too. The prices of the hostels vary from seventeen to thirty euros per individual.
